What we measured, and what we didn't

Our audit protocol is the same for every operator: real deposits from our own bankroll, withdrawals timed from confirm-click to spendable wallet balance, repeated across a 90-day window at randomised hours. Cinoslots sits inside our published top eight, so its numbers are part of the public audit dataset: 318 timed withdrawals, a 4-second Lightning median, 99.6% first-pass success, KYC untriggered below the disclosed $20,000-equivalent cumulative mark.

Stake was tested inside the same window but does not appear in our published ranking. The honest reason: it scored below the 9.0 Trust Index line our methodology requires, with the deductions concentrated in two criteria. First, withdrawal consistency: our sample showed materially wider variance between the fastest and slowest cash-outs than any operator in our top eight, driven by risk-review holds that fire without a stated trigger. Second, bonus transparency: Stake's headline offers rotate frequently and the effective terms (wagering, game weighting, expiry) take more digging to assemble than the industry norm. We publish per-operator transaction counts only for ranked operators, so we will not quote a fabricated-looking precise median for Stake here; the qualitative finding is that it was slower on median and much wider on spread.

Where Stake wins

Originals. Stake's in-house provably-fair catalogue (Crash, Dice, Plinko, Mines and the rest) is the deepest in the industry, and the seed-verification tooling is genuinely good. Cinoslots ships a smaller in-house suite; if provably-fair originals are the bulk of your play, Stake's catalogue is a real advantage.

Scale and liquidity. Six-figure withdrawals that would trip a manual review at most operators are routine at Stake's volume. High-rollers who value that headroom have a rational reason to be there.

Social layer. The rain feature, the chat culture, the VIP host model: none of it exists at Cinoslots in comparable form. It isn't our scoring criterion, but plenty of players weight it.
